aboutsummaryrefslogtreecommitdiff
path: root/server-fn.c
diff options
context:
space:
mode:
authornicm <nicm>2015-04-22 15:32:33 +0000
committernicm <nicm>2015-04-22 15:32:33 +0000
commit9a453dd3546b2c3053e8e34bf4d6775b1a05d3a8 (patch)
treebc2feb485e0aabb60a51f04ddc5f4b88926b807e /server-fn.c
parent8d66f4fba4972d45be64d108c7c8d952f85016a8 (diff)
downloadrtmux-9a453dd3546b2c3053e8e34bf4d6775b1a05d3a8.tar.gz
rtmux-9a453dd3546b2c3053e8e34bf4d6775b1a05d3a8.tar.bz2
rtmux-9a453dd3546b2c3053e8e34bf4d6775b1a05d3a8.zip
Make session_has return a flag, returning the first winlink found is a
recipe for errors.
Diffstat (limited to 'server-fn.c')
-rw-r--r--server-fn.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/server-fn.c b/server-fn.c
index 83ea9474..c5487aa6 100644
--- a/server-fn.c
+++ b/server-fn.c
@@ -199,7 +199,7 @@ server_status_window(struct window *w)
*/
RB_FOREACH(s, sessions, &sessions) {
- if (session_has(s, w) != NULL)
+ if (session_has(s, w))
server_status_session(s);
}
}
@@ -268,7 +268,7 @@ server_kill_window(struct window *w)
s = next_s;
next_s = RB_NEXT(sessions, &sessions, s);
- if (session_has(s, w) == NULL)
+ if (!session_has(s, w))
continue;
server_unzoom_window(w);
while ((wl = winlink_find_by_window(&s->windows, w)) != NULL) {